#include<bits/stdc++.h>
using namespace std;
int main()
{
long long int n,x1,x2,x3,x4,x5,x6,a,b,c;
scanf("%d",&n);
scanf("%d %d",&x1,&x2);
scanf("%d %d",&x3,&x4);
scanf("%d %d",&x5,&x6);
if(n%x1==0)
{a=n/x1*x2;}
else
{a=(n/x1+1)*x2;}
if(n%x3==0)
{b=n/x3*x4;}
else
{b=(n/x3+1)*x4;}
if(n%x5==0)
{c=n/x5*x6;}
else
{c=(n/x5+1)*x6;}
if(a>b)
swap(a,b);
if(a>c)
swap(a,c);
printf("%d",&a);
return 0;
}